Learning Pod
A Learning Pod is a small, student-centered learning group within the Pathfinder Educational Model that replaces large, impersonal classrooms with personalized, interactive education. Learning Pods are designed to foster collaborative, peer-based learning in intimate, flexible settings.

Notes
Learning Pods ensure human-centered, personalized education that empowers students while maintaining flexibility, adaptability, and community engagement.
Key Features:
- Small, Personalized Groups: Typically consisting of 5-12 students, ensuring individualized attention.
- Parent and Educator Involvement: Parents, mentors, or Learning Hub educators facilitate learning, with Pathfinder AI providing additional guidance and customization.
- Collaborative and Adaptive: Students work together, exploring real-world problems, creative projects, and interdisciplinary learning.
- Social and Emotional Development: Prioritizes psychological well-being, trauma-informed learning, and emotional intelligence.
Learning Pod Structure:
- Elementary Level: Pods remain small (5-7 students), with parent involvement in early learning.
- High School Level: Pods expand to 10-12 students, incorporating more independent learning, AI support, and research projects.
- Lifelong Learning Pods: Open to adults and professionals, offering continued education and skill development.
